Hoxhaj: Kosovo without any recognition that four years has lost international moment

Democratic Party of Kosovo MP Enver Hoxhaj has said that Palestine, though in war condition, has managed to restore the international moment, from which it is receiving successive recognition. Deputy Speaker of the Enver Hoxhaj Parliament, through a writing on the social Facebook network, has said that last week Jamaica, Barbados, Trinidad and Tobago recognised Palestine's independence, and this month Spain, Ireland and Slovenia will also recognise it, he wrote.
And that, according to Hoxhaj, shows that Palestine, despite the Gaza War, has restored its moment.
Kosovo has finally lost its international moment. This is the price Kosovo is paying without any foreign policy.”, Hoxhaj wrote.
